What is a Coffee Spoon?

A coffee spoon, as the name suggests, is a small spoon specifically designed for stirring coffee. It is usually smaller than a teaspoon and has a unique shape that makes it perfect for mixing sugar, cream, or any other additions into your cup of coffee. Coffee spoons are generally made from stainless steel, which ensures their durability and resistance to staining.

The History of Coffee Spoons

Coffee spoons have a rich history, dating back to the 18th century. During this time, the consumption of coffee became increasingly popular, leading to the development of specialized utensils. Coffee spoons were designed to accommodate the growing coffee culture and provide a convenient tool for stirring the beverage.

Types of Coffee Spoons

Coffee spoons come in various designs and styles, each catering to different preferences and needs. Here are a few types of coffee spoons commonly found in the market:

Long-handled Coffee Spoons

These spoons feature an extended handle, making them perfect for stirring coffee in a tall cup or a travel mug. The longer handle ensures that your hand stays away from the heat, reducing the risk of burns. Additionally, it allows for a more comfortable grip, providing better control while stirring.

Espresso Spoons

Espresso spoons are specifically designed for stirring and serving espresso. They are smaller in size compared to regular coffee spoons and are often accompanied by espresso cups. These spoons are ideal for those who enjoy the strong and concentrated taste of espresso.

Decorative Coffee Spoons

For coffee lovers who appreciate aesthetics, decorative coffee spoons are an excellent choice. These spoons often feature intricate designs on the handle, adding a touch of elegance and sophistication to your coffee rituals. While their primary purpose remains the same, these spoons can also serve as decorative items to complement your coffee setup.

Caring for Your Coffee Spoons

To ensure the longevity of your coffee spoons, it is essential to care for them properly. Here are a few tips for maintaining your coffee spoons:

Handwashing

While many utensils can be safely cleaned in a dishwasher, it is best to handwash your coffee spoons. This gentle cleaning method helps preserve the spoon’s appearance and prevents potential damage. Use mild soap and warm water to remove any coffee residue before drying them with a soft cloth.

Avoid Harsh Cleaners

Avoid using abrasive or harsh cleaning agents on your coffee spoons, as they can cause scratches and dull the spoon’s surface. Opt for mild cleansers specifically formulated for stainless steel utensils to maintain their shine and integrity.

Proper Storage

When not in use, it is advisable to store your coffee spoons in a dedicated spoon holder or a separate compartment to prevent them from coming into contact with other utensils. This will help minimize any potential scratches or damage.
